Model Overview:

Mazda has a tradition of building entertaining small cars, and the Mazda 3 fits right in with its sharp handling and engaging nature. But it's also a practical, affordable runabout that's available as either a sedan or a handy four-door hatchback. A Mazda 3 of any vintage is worth consideration, but the 3's interior quality has improved dramatically over time. Likewise, fuel economy has emerged as a real strength in recent years.

Introduced in 2004, the Mazda 3 has always been one of those cars that feels a little bit special when you get behind the wheel. Some shoppers might find the ride too firm, but if you like to drive, you'll probably take a shine to this compact Mazda. Passenger room is the same in the sedan and hatchback, but the latter offers more cargo room. If fuel economy is a priority, note that 2012 and later models benefit from updated engine technology that helps the car return significantly better mileage.

    I have 2000 mi. so far. All city miles so far. Mileage has steadily climbed starting at 28.5 to 31 mpg. There seems to be a gearing gap from 1st to 2nd gear. Trunk is roomy and back seats work great for my 7 and 11 yr olds. I think there should be more interior colors available. I wish there was a 6th gear for the highway. Not sure why the a/c turns on when you turn the temperature control know back all the way to cool.
